If you're looking for a place to build your home
page or store your files, check out this impressive list of services who offer free
webspace. Be prepared to accept some advertising gimmicks for their free offers.
Some, such as Geocities, have those annoying pop-up window ads and others, such as
Xoom, paste their header on at the top of your pages. Methods vary with the hosting
service. All in all, even with the ads, it's a pretty good deal. Most offer a
multitude of goodies, such as page counters, guest books and page building tools.
Keep in mind these services give you webspace so they can sell advertising.
The more members they collect, the more valuable their ad space becomes. We
can't speak for all the services on this list but we have tried many of them at one time
or another.
Acme City
20 MB of space, community environment, email, message board, HTML help. Fairly large
header will appear at the top of your pages but it includes a search engine.
Angelfire
Communications
5 MB of space, community environment, page counters, page editor, graphics library you can
link to and not use up your webspace, no paid ads allowed but you may promote your own
business, free email is available. Angelfire is owned by Lycos. It appears the
ads appear on their pages but none are placed on your pages.
CrossWinds
Unlimited space, yes, UNLIMITED, free email, Majordomo mailing lists,
CGI access, page counter and tons of great stuff. One of the better services for
business or personal sites. No ads are required on you pages from what we viewed.
CyberCities
25 MB of space, POP email account, free domain name search and registration
available, free domain parking, low-cost, full hosting services available for domain when
you are ready. No advertising is required on your pages.
Dencity.com
25 MB of space, comes with a bulletin board and daily stats are available to show who is
visiting your pages. No banner ads are permitted on your pages. Unknown if
they require their ads on your pages.
EasySpace
25 MB of space, free email account, some member support and more.
A banner or image link is required on your pages but you can choose from several
and some are very small.
EmailChoice.com
15 MB of storage space to use for transferring files, online diary, message boards,
reminder service, bookmark manager and a great online email service. Home page
service will be offered in the future.
ememories.com
Free service will create a picture album from your uploaded images. Presented in
framed pages that contain banner ads for ememories and their sponsors. Visitors can leave
comments and you will be notified by email when they do. Your choice of private or
public viewing. Very nice service and pictures are displayed nicely.
Fiberia
Free Web Pages
11 MB of web space, FTP access for uploading, CGI for dynamic web pages, SSL secure pages.
Free mail form script and counter are included. Large header appears at the top of
your pages.
Fortune City
20 MB of space, large community style environment, free email account,
page builder and FTP service. Very nice service with good community spirit and lots
of goodies. A large banner/navigation image appears on the top of your pages but it
seems a fair price for what you get for free.
Free Speech Internet
Television
25 MB of space, access to RealServer, unlimited transfer. No
commercial sites and you must join to receive your space. Very nice site for anyone
interested in audio/video web publication. No ads are required.
FreeYellow
12 MB of space, banner ads are encouraged and affiliate program is offered. Banner
ad appears on your pages. Very commercialized but service is decent.
fsn - free sites
network
30 MB of space for hosting your top level domain (www.yourdomain.com)
or a virtual domain (yourname.fsn.net) in exchange for placing their ads at the top and
bottom of your pages. Unlimited data transfer, no set up fee and your own FTP
account. There are very few services offered and the ads on the pages are a pain but
there are almost no limitations on content. Adult sites are welcome as long as they
remain within fsn's guidelines.
Geocities
11 MB of space, large community environment, tons of goodies including, counters, guest
book, search box, games, headlines and java. Geocities is one of the oldest and
largest of the free web space providers and has recently teamed up with Yahoo.com.
Ads permitted by approval. Annoying pop-up window ad appears if you don't opt for
the top of your page banner ads.
TheGlobe.com
12 MB of space, very large community environment, free email, page building tools,
calendar and address book. Services and goodies too numerous to mention. Large
header ad appears at the top of your pages. A very good offering even with the ads.
GO Network
Appears to be unlimited space for your pages if you sign up for their personal start page,
free email, handy moving service to copy your current site to their service, and page
builder. Unknown if FTP is permitted or the type of ads, if any, placed on your
pages.
Homepages for the
Homepageless
3 MB of space, guest book, page counter, other items available for free area. A bit
off-beat community type setup. Site is hard to navigate but interesting. Small
banner link must be added to the bottom of your pages. A division of
TrailorPark.com.
Hometown
AOL
2 MB of space per screen name. (You can have up to 5 screen names per account so it could
total 10 MB of space) Community style environment, well policed for violations of
building regulations, quick, easy page builder, search features, guest book, counters and
other features. Nice for AOL users. Large header appears on the top of your
pages.
(Foot Note: AOL users may also FTP to their account names and avoid the
AOL advertisements but there is no community support.)
iGiftShops
200 MB of space, Control Panel, FrontPage
extensions, CGI-scripts collection, shopping cart, CyberCash and you get paid a commission
for sale of their gifts. Not a site to build a personal homepage but a great service
if you have an interest in starting an online business.
iVillage - The
Women's Network
5 MB of space, free email, large community environment for women, other nice features
included for your page and membership. Membership to iVillage is required to get
free space but there is no charge for joining. Pleasant site with nice services.
Standard ad/navigation banner appears on the top of your pages.
Lycos
Appears to be 11 MB of space, community type environment, free email account available
from MailCity, easy to use page builder, graphics and photo library, page templates and
other features. Lycos is affiliated with Tripod and Angelfire.
Max Pages
100 pages to a site. Max Pages does not create true
HTML files so the limit is expressed in pages rather than megabytes. Use of images
is restricted to MaxPages' library. Using your own images or HTML files disqualifies
you from their free status. Guest book, search and lots of other goodies.
Banner ads are placed on your pages by their page builder.
McAfee Online
15 MB of space to be used for homepage or personal file storage that is accessible from
any of your computers, email account, online calendar, photo album, message board, address
book and task list. From the creators of the best known virus protection programs,
their Briefcase deal is hard to beat. Unknown if ads are required on your pages.but
with all they offer it would be a small price to pay. You have to see this one to
believe it.
MSN Homepages
12 MB of space, large community type environment, page builder service with lots of
templates and high-tech features, EZ Web Transfer to move your existing site to your new
MSN address, free email account available from HotMail, keyword search of members' pages,
and much more. Annoying pop-up ad window, but worth the aggravation for what you
receive. Typical of MicroSoft, it has it all and it's user friendly.
MyFamily.Com
Unsure of the space limits but it must be sizable due to the features they offer.
Personal news bulletin board, calendar, family album, family file cabinet for sharing
GEDCOM files and others, chat area with notification of who's online, email handler,
bookmark organizer, family tree viewer, recipe file, kids pages and much more. If
you are into genealogy or keeping family together, this is THE place for you. Pages
follow their templates and their logo and ads appear on your pages.
NetTaxi
10 MB of space, one free email account, community type environment,
page builder and access to chat, bulletin boards and more. Large header
ad/navigation bar appears on the top of all your pages.
ProHosting
15 MB of space, 1 FTP account, and best of all: NO ADS required.
Good service and no catches other than an occasional email ad from ProHosting.
Spree.com
Unlimited space when you sign up as a partner and put their products on your page, guest
book, page counter, chat, and more. Your site serves as an advertising billboard for
their products but you get paid for it and all the free space you want. Works out
well for some people.
Tony-Net
Unlimited Web space anunlimited web space, access to all of the latest Front Page
extensions, CGI and Perl, DNS, Real Audio Streaming, free email, and newsgroups.
Notice: Free Service has been suspended. Unknown if it will be available at a
later date.
Tripod
11 MB of space, page builder, lots of great options, large community style environment,
lots of page goodies, and images. Annoying pop-up ads. Still one of the best
available free deals in spite of the pop-up window.
Virtual Avenue
20 MB of space, CGI access, SSI, Frontpage, FTP support, unlimited traffic, domain
transfer, www.yourname.com or a virtual domain - www.yourname.virtualave.net, and much
more. You are given a choice of putting their banner ad at the top of your pages or
having a pop-up window ad. This deal seams almost too good to be true.
Notice: If you choose to use a domain name, there is a $70 fee from InterNik
but no charge from Virtual Avenue for their assistance in securing it.
Web Jump
25 MB of space, unlimited bandwith, Standard Perl/CGI/Scripts, page
builder, file manager utility, and other goodies. Good service and support. A
header with ads appears at the top of all your pages.
Xoom!
Unlimited space, yes I did say UNLIMITED. They increased their old deal of 11 MB and
threw in a few more deals to boot. Large community style environment, free email
account, huge library of clipart, page builder, affiliate deals offered, chat room and
lots more. A moderate navigation bar/ad apears at the top of your pages but it's
worth it for what you get. One drawback is their slow speed.
